NUJ Disclaims Nwadike, Cohorts’ Caretaker Committee in Imo Council
ThankGod Emeh.
The leadership and members of the Nigeria Union of Journalists, NUJ, Imo Council, has disclaimed the activities of a group of persons led by the Publisher of Nigeria Watchdog Newspaper, Precious Nwadike who are parading themselves as Caretaker Committee of NUJ in Imo Council, describing them as “impersonators and mischief makers who mean no good for the union”
“The attention of the leadership and members of the Nigeria Union of Journalists, NUJ, Imo Council, has been drawn to the activities of a group of persons led by the Publisher of Nigeria Watchdog Newspaper, Precious Nwadike who are parading themselves as Caretaker Committee of NUJ in Imo Council.”
The executive of Imo Council of the Nigeria Union of Journalists in a recent meeting states categorically “That the NUJ in Imo Council has an executive led by Chief Chris Akaraonye whose three year tenure has been running since 2019” and “That there is no Caretaker Committee in Imo Council of the NUJ and anyone parading or impersonating as such is doing so at his or her own risk”
The Excos of the council also added that “the executive leadership of every Council in NUJ emerges through an electoral process that is supervised by the National leadership of the Union”
They stressed that “the said Precious Nwadike is a publisher of a newspaper and is not a member of Imo Council of the NUJ” while noting that “law enforcement agencies are investigating this clear case of impersonation and will take care of the matter according to the laws of the land”
The NUJ is advising everyone especially the unsuspecting public to beware of the activities of the said Caretaker Committee whose aim is to defraud the unsuspecting public.
